B-LCDADDSI to HDMI adapter | Development Boards, Kits, Programmers | 2 | Active | The DSI to LCD adapter board (order code B-LCDAD-RPI1) provides a flexible connector from the microcontroller motherboard (Samtec High speed connector QTH-030) to the standard LCD connector (TE 1-1734248).
It can be used on STM32 Evaluation or Discovery boards which supports DSI connector, to connect DSI to LCD adapter board for LCD applications. |
B-MOTOR-PMSMA150W DC motor and power adaptor for ZeST discovery kit | Evaluation and Demonstration Boards and Kits | 1 | Active | The B-MOTOR-PMSMA1 50 W motor and power adapter package is primarily intended to demonstrate the FOC control method in the framework of a low-cost motor control application. It is designed to operate with the ZeST motor control development platform. It includes a R57BLB50L2 motor from MOONS' and a GST90A24-TW AC power adapter from MEAN WELL.
The R57BLB50L2 motor connects to the power board of the ZeST motor control development platform.
The GST90A24-TW power adapter is a 90 W AC/DC power adapter, which powers the power board. It can also supply the whole ZeST motor control development platform. It does not include an AC power cord.
The R57BLB50L2 motor and the GST90A24-TW power adapter are supplied by third parties not affiliated to STMicroelectronics. For complete and latest information, refer to the third-party web pages mentioned in the ordering information section of the data brief. |

B-U585I-IOT02ADiscovery kit for IoT node with STM32U5 series | Evaluation Boards | 1 | Active | The B-U585I-IOT02A Discovery kit provides a complete demonstration and development platform for the STM32U585AI microcontroller, featuring an Arm®Cortex®-M33 core with Arm®TrustZone®and Armv8-M mainline security extension, 2 Mbytes of Flash memory and 786 Kbytes of SRAM, as well as smart peripheral resources.
This Discovery kit enables a wide diversity of applications by exploiting low-power communication, multiway sensing, and direct connection to cloud servers.
It includes Wi-Fi®and Bluetooth®modules, as well as microphones, temperature and humidity, magnetometer, accelerometer and gyroscope, pressure, time-of-flight, and gesture-detection sensors.
The support for ARDUINO®Uno V3, STMod+, and Pmod™ connectivity provides unlimited expansion capabilities with a large choice of specialized add-on boards.
For even more user-friendliness, the on-board STLINK-V3E debugger provides out-of-the-box loading and debugging capabilities, as well as a USB Virtual COM port bridge.
The B-U585I-IOT02A Discovery kit leverages the STM32U5 Series key assets to enable prototyping for a variety of wearable or sensor applications in fitness, metering, industrial, or medical, with state-of-the-art energy efficiency and higher security. |
B-WB1M-WPAN1Connectivity expansion board with STM32WB1MMC module | Expansion Boards, Daughter Cards | 1 | Active | The B-WB1M-WPAN1 STM32WB connectivity expansion board provides an affordable and flexible way for users to try out new concepts and build prototypes with the STM32WB series STM32WB1MMC microcontroller module.
The B-WB1M-WPAN1 product requires a separate probe for programming and debugging. The STLINK-V3SET debugger can be connected through a MIPI10/STDC14 cable.
The B-WB1M-WPAN1 STM32WB connectivity expansion board is provided with a USB Type-C®connector (for power only) on an add-on STMod+ adapter board.
The B-WB1M-WPAN1 product is provided with the STM32WB comprehensive software HAL library and various packaged software examples available with the STM32CubeWB MCU Package. |

BAL-CC1101-01D350Ω nominal input / conjugate match balun to CC1101, with integrated harmonic filter | RF and Wireless | 1 | Obsolete | STMicroelectronics BAL-CC1101-01D3 is an ultra miniature balun which integrates a matching network in a monolithic glass substrate. This has been customized for the CC1101 / CC1150 TI transceiver.
It’s a design using STMicroelectronics IPD (integrated passive device) technology on non-conductive glass substrate to optimize RF performance. |
BAL-NRF01D350Ω nominal input / conjugate match balun to nRF24LE1 & nRF51822-QFAA, with integrated harmonic filter | RF and Wireless | 1 | Active | STMicroelectronics BAL-NRF01D3 is an ultraminiature balun. The device integrates matching network and harmonics filter. Matching impedance has been customized for the following Nordic Semiconductor circuits: nRF24LE1 QFN-32 pins, nRF24AP2-1CH, nRF24AP2-8CH, nRF51422-QFAA (build code CA/C0), nRF51822-QFAA (build code CA/C0) and nRF51822-QFAB (build code AA/A0).
The device uses STMicroelectronics’ IPD technology on a non-conductive glass substrate to optimize RF performance.
The BAL-NRF01D3 has been tested and approved by Nordic Semiconductor in their nRF2723 and nRF2752 nRFgo modules. |
BAL-NRF02D350Ω nominal input / conjugate match balun to nRF51822-CEAA, with integrated harmonic filter | RF and Wireless | 1 | Active | STMicroelectronics BAL-NRF02D3 is an ultraminiature balun. The BAL-NRF02D3 integrates matching network and harmonics filter. Matching impedance has been customized for the following Nordic Semiconductor circuits: nRF51422-CEAA, nRF51422-CDAB, nRF51422- CFAC and nRF51822-CEAA, nRF51822-CDAB, nRF51822-CFAC.
The BAL-NRF02D3 uses STMicroelectronics IPD technology on non-conductive glass substrate which optimizes RF performance.
The BAL-NRF02D3 has been tested and approved by Nordic Semiconductor in the nRFgo modules. |
